  • Page 4: Normal Conditions

    2.2 Normal Conditions Under normal input conditions (see section 4.2) energy from the mains is channelled through the input converter, which supplies the output converter and, together with the battery charger, keeps the battery fully charged. Surges and spikes are blocked completely at the input converter and very unstable mains can be supported.
  • Page 5: Bypass Operation

    2.4 Bypass operation The static switch provides transfer of the load to the line voltage without any interruption of the supply. The transfer is initiated by a signal from the output converter protection circuit in case of an overload, high temperature or output converter failure. When the conditions return to normal the load is automatically transferred back to the output converter.

  • Page 8: Standard Features

    4. STANDARD FEATURES Automatic (quick) battery test The LP Series family UPS conducts periodic automatic battery tests to ensure that the batteries and the wiring are healthy and able to support power failures. The tests do not cause any interruption in the function of the unit. Automatic tests are conducted after every 500 operating hours.

  • Page 10: Potential Free Contact Interface

    5.2 Potential Free Contact Interface Four potential free change-over contacts are available for signalling the following alarms to a user defined system: • bypass active; • mains failure; • battery low; • general alarm. Capacity of the relay contacts: Nom: 48V 500mA Min: 5V 100mA...
